Peach Honey Float (Lightened)

From *Cooking With Honey* by Hazel Berto, this recipe works as a tasty dessert drink or after school treat for the kids. I modified the original recipe from whole milk to skim & ice cream to frozen yoghurt, so feel free to revert to the original if you have a DH w/more willpower than my Siggi. *Enjoy* Show more

Ready In: 10 mins

Serves: 4-5

Ingredients

  • 2  fresh peaches (med size, ripe, peeled, pitted, coarsely crushed & chilled)
  • 14 cup honey
  • 1  pint skim milk
  • 14 teaspoon  almond extract
  • 1  pint  vanilla frozen yogurt

Directions

  1. Combine peaches, honey + 1/2 pt milk & beat or blend.
  2. Add rest of the milk, almond extract + half of the frozen yoghurt & beat or blend till smooth.
  3. Pour into well-chilled tall glasses, top w/remaining frozen yoghurt & serve immediately.
  4. NOTE: We would always use fresh peaches for this, but they cannot always be in season & I bet this would still be good using canned peaches when fresh are not an option.
